config 802.1x auth_protocol
Purpose Used to configure the 802.1x authentication protocol on the
Switch.
Syntax
config 802.1x auth_protocol [local | radius_eap]
Description
The config 802.1x auth_protocol command enables you to
configure the authentication protocol.
Parameters [local | radius_eap] – Specify the type of authentication protocol
desired.
Restrictions Only Administrator-level users can issue this command.
Example usage:
To configure the authentication protocol on the Switch:
DES-3026:4# config 802.1x auth_protocol local
Command: config 802.1x auth_protocol local
Success.
DES-3026:4#
config 802.1x init
Purpose Used to initialize the 802.1x function on a range of ports.
Syntax
config 802.1x init [port_based ports [<portlist> | all] | mac_based ports
[<portlist> | all] {mac_address <macaddr>}]
Description
The config 802.1x init command is used to immediately initialize the
802.1x functions on a specified range of ports or for specified MAC
addresses operating from a specified range of ports.
Parameters port_based ports – This instructs the Switch to initialize 802.1x functions
based only on the port number. Ports approved for initialization can then be
specified.
<portlist> Specifies a port or range of ports to be initialized.
